This year has turned out to be a very interesting ballot. We've had 50 different productions nominated, with many new styles of art nominated. We have DJs, painters, sculptors and even banned artists on the list. This year's Hecklers are a perfect representation of the beautiful melting pot that is Hong Kong's art scene.
